Health Risks of Sewage Exposure

* Infectious diseases: Raw sewage contains pathogens that can cause illnesses such as hepatitis A, E. coli infections, and cryptosporidiosis.
* Respiratory problems: Inhalation of sewage vapors can irritate the throat and lungs, leading to coughing, wheezing, and respiratory distress.
* Skin infections: Direct contact with sewage can cause skin rashes, infections, and abscesses.
* Gastrointestinal issues: Ingestion of contaminated food or water can result in n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and abdominal cramps.

Symptoms of Raw Sewage Exposure

The symptoms of raw sewage exposure vary depending on the route of exposure and the individual’s immune system. Some common symptoms include:

  • Fever and chills
  • Nausea and vomiting
  • Diarrhea
  • Abdominal pain
  • Skin irritation and rash
  • Eye irritation and redness
  • Respiratory problems
